What Can I Substitute For Instant Coffee In A Recipe?

As a beverage you can use brewed coffee of course. OR – For baking, brew double-strength coffee. 1 teaspoon of espresso powder is equal to 3 ounces of espresso or double-strength coffee. OR – Use a grain-based coffee substitute like Postum or Pero. Can I use regular coffee grounds instead of instant in a recipe? … Read more

Is Coffee Extract Actual Coffee?

coffee extract is a product of using coffee beans and alcohol to create a concentrated coffee flavoring that can be used in baked goods, ice cream, and cocktails. Whole coffee beans are crushed up coarsely, and mixed with alcohol over a period of weeks. Does coffee extract have real coffee? Coffee extract is the compound … Read more
